If I am filing for bankruptcy and am current on my rent but have 1 1/2 years left in my lease, does my landlord have to know????
Kevin's answer
|
Answered on August 13, 2018
If you have a long-term lease and formally accept the lease through your Chapter 7, the landlord would be served with a bankruptcy notice.

Can a traffic ticket in collections be included in a ch7 bankruptcy ?
Kevin's answer
|
Answered on August 13, 2018
Traffic tickets are not discharged in chapter 7 but are in chapter 13. If it is a criminal traffic fine, it is not discharged in either.

We put a lien on former renters property, do we need to notify her, or does the bank do that ?
Kevin's answer
|
Answered on July 09, 2018
The lien is recorded. The debtor can check county records to verify if a lien was recorded against her property.
